Understanding Microtechniques: A Guide to Specialized Techniques for Small Scale Work

Microtechnique is a French term that can be translated as "micro-technique" or "microscopic technique". It refers to the use of specialized techniques and tools to perform tasks or procedures at a very small scale, typically on the order of micrometers or smaller.

In various fields such as biology, chemistry, materials science, and engineering, microtechniques are used to study, manipulate, and analyze small structures and phenomena that are not visible to the naked eye. These techniques often involve the use of specialized instruments and equipment, such as microscopes, nanotools, and other precision instruments.

Some examples of microtechniques include:

1. Microdissection: a technique used to isolate specific tissues or cells from a larger sample using a microscope and specialized tools.
2. Microinjection: a technique used to inject small amounts of substances into specific locations within a sample, such as cells or organs.
3. Microdispensing: a technique used to deposit very small amounts of materials onto a surface, such as in the fabrication of microelectromechanical systems (MEMS) devices.
4. Microscopy: a technique used to study samples using a microscope, which can provide high-resolution images and information about the sample's structure and composition.
5. Nanofabrication: a technique used to create structures and devices at the nanoscale using specialized tools and techniques, such as electron beam lithography and ion beam milling.
